Output a70b968a3f1cea971b06efef4dce3611f5f085ff34983c9e0e8e4ee71b785397:20

value
1025869
script pubkey
OP_0 OP_PUSHBYTES_20 df2f8981644ccdf4d1911d81a8b475425aeb40a7
address
bc1qmuhcnqtyfnxlf5v3rkq63dr4gfdwks98wj2m8u
transaction
a70b968a3f1cea971b06efef4dce3611f5f085ff34983c9e0e8e4ee71b785397
confirmations
153471
spent
true